520 _aBook Details Environmental sciences is a vast and multidisciplinary science that involves the study of natural resources of land, water, and air. Introduction to Environmental Sciences comprehensively covers numerous aspects of this vast subject. The book focuses on the causes of environmental problems and methods and ways of mitigating these causes. It covers topics such as biostatistics, principles of analytic method, disaster management, various chemical processes operating in the environment, greenhouse gases emissions, global warming, among others. The book will prove beneficial to those involved in environmental studies, environmental management, community health practice, to mention some. Key Features :- *Covers various manual and instrumental methods *Gives comprehensive coverage of environmental statistics *Focuses on sustainability and environmental chemistry *Deals with greenhouse gas emissions and global warming Also includes illustrations and index.
